The Naturalization Act of 1795 set the First policies on naturalization: "free of charge, White individuals" who were resident for five years or more.[315] An 1862 regulation permitted honorably discharged Military veterans of any war to petition for naturalization immediately after only one 12 months of residence in The usa.

The Child Citizenship Act of 2000 streamlined the naturalization system for children adopted internationally. A kid under age 18 that is adopted by a minimum of one particular US citizen father or mother, which is within the custody in the citizen dad or mum(s), is now instantly naturalized the moment admitted to America being an immigrant or when lawfully adopted in The usa, based on the visa under which the child was admitted to The us.

No particular person, apart from as if not offered With this subchapter, shall be naturalized unless this sort of applicant, (1) right away preceding the date of filing his software for naturalization has resided repeatedly, following staying lawfully admitted for long-lasting home, within just America for a minimum of 5 years And through the five years instantly preceding the day of submitting his software continues to be bodily existing therein for intervals totaling at the very least 50 % of that time, and that has resided within the Condition or inside the district on the Support in The us through which the applicant Asylum filed the applying for a minimum of three months, (two) has resided repeatedly within just America with the date of the applying approximately time of admission to citizenship, and (3) in the course of every one of the intervals referred to Within this subsection continues to be and continue to is anyone of excellent ethical character, connected to the principles of the Structure of America, and properly disposed to The nice buy and happiness of The us.[313]

Lawful everlasting residents also are not able to vote, but most citizens can. One exception is that US citizens can not vote for president in the overall election when residing in among the territories.
